I$655 <br />2. Rented for an amount na more than one hun- <br />dred twenty percent [1200 of the last month's rent <br />paid by the tenant to the owner o~ the property to <br />be converted. Rent shall not include money paid or <br />charges collected by the lessor for the provision of <br />utility services. <br />3. The same number of bedrooms. <br />4. Similar kitchen and bath facilities. <br />5. Similar special facilities for the particular <br />tenant's needs if that tenant~is handicapped or elderly, <br />including but not limited to elevators and security <br />features. <br />6. Similar cooling and heating systems. <br />7. Similar accessibility in terms of time of <br />travel and distance from public transportation routes <br />to the tenants place of employment, community and <br />commercial facilities, schools, medical services and <br />transportation. <br />8. Such other factors as may be identified in <br />administrative rules issued hereunder. A unit is not <br />comparable if it is located in a building for which <br />a notice of planned conversion has been given or for <br />which reasonable evidence exists that the owner of <br />such building is contemplating conversion to condominium <br />or cooperati~re units. "Comparable housing" does not <br />include: any hotel,~motel or other similar structure or <br />room therein used primarily for transient occupancy, in <br />which at least 60n of the rooms is devoted to living <br />quarters for short term tenants or guests or used for <br />transient occupancy; any rental unit in an establishment <br />which has as its primary purpose the providing of diag- <br />nostic care and treatment of diseases, including but <br />not limited to hospitals, convalescent homes, nursing <br />homes and personal care homes; or any dormitory or in- <br />stitute of higher education, or private boarding school <br />dwelling unit which is pro~rided for student occupancy. <br />Condominium -- land, whether leasehold or in fee simple <br />and all buildings, improvements, and structures thereon, <br />where the ownership of such land is shared in undivided <br />interests except far exclusive and separate ownership ar <br />right of residency of each residential unit located an the <br />land.
